Transaction 1114b72e211089568379709d29f5d01cec9c12717651868a24144adbfc690ac2

1 Input
2 Outputs
  • 1114b72e211089568379709d29f5d01cec9c12717651868a24144adbfc690ac2:0
  • value  310000
    address  36YBy9N3Fj1HUvtTZGX2E37JLdTkF1mypE
  • 1114b72e211089568379709d29f5d01cec9c12717651868a24144adbfc690ac2:1
  • value  1424686
    address  145EdKYHhgYEM44xMjMmJxx1B5CtgJ8gEG